Reporting Nursing Home Abuse in Florida

If you or a loved one has been the victim of nursing home abuse, immediately document and report the problem. Make your report in writing, date it, and keep a copy for yourself. Include the following in your report:

  • The name, age, and address of the victim
  • The name of the facility and those responsible for the abuse
  • The nature and extent of harm and physical signs of abuse
  • The time and date of the incident
  • A description of any previous incidents
